Is 116 785 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 116 785 is about 341.738.

Thus, the square root of 116 785 is not an integer, and therefore 116 785 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 116 785?

The square of a number (here 116 785) is the result of the product of this number (116 785) by itself (i.e., 116 785 × 116 785); the square of 116 785 is sometimes called "raising 116 785 to the power 2", or "116 785 squared".

The square of 116 785 is 13 638 736 225 because 116 785 × 116 785 = 116 7852 = 13 638 736 225.

As a consequence, 116 785 is the square root of 13 638 736 225.
